Struct ql2::Query [−][src]
You send one of:
- A [START] query with a Term to evaluate and a unique-per-connection token.
- A [CONTINUE] query with the same token as a [START] query that returned [SUCCESS_PARTIAL] in its Response.
- A [STOP] query with the same token as a [START] query that you want to stop.
- A [NOREPLY_WAIT] query with a unique per-connection token. The server answers with a [WAIT_COMPLETE] Response.
- A [SERVER_INFO] query. The server answers with a [SERVER_INFO] Response.
Fields
type: Option<i32>
query: Option<Term>
A Term is how we represent the operations we want a query to perform.
only present when [type] = [START]
token: Option<i64>
obsolete_noreply: Option<bool>
This flag is ignored on the server. noreply
should be added
to global_optargs
instead (the key “noreply” should map to
either true or false).
accepts_r_json: Option<bool>
If this is set to true, then Datum values will sometimes be of [DatumType] [R_JSON] (see below). This can provide enormous speedups in languages with poor protobuf libraries.
global_optargs: Vec<AssocPair>
